RFID Technology
RFID technology has greatly improved the efficiency and accuracy of track and trace solution. With RFID tags, inventory management has become more streamlined and automated. These small electronic devices can be attached to products, allowing for real-time tracking throughout the supply chain.
Unlike traditional barcodes, which require line-of-sight scanning, RFID tags can be read from a distance and even through packaging materials. This not only saves time but also reduces human error in data entry.
Additionally, RFID technology enables supply chain optimization by providing valuable insights into product movement and identifying bottlenecks or inefficiencies. By leveraging this technology, businesses can proactively address issues in their supply chain to improve overall performance and customer satisfaction.

GPS-enabled Devices
GPS devices have revolutionized the way we track and locate items. With real-time tracking and high location accuracy, these devices have become essential tools in the logistics industry.
GPS-enabled trackers allow businesses to precisely monitor their assets, vehicles, and shipments. By attaching a GPS device to an item or vehicle, companies can easily keep tabs on its exact location at any given time. This technology provides real-time updates on movement and allows for quick response in case of theft or loss.
Moreover, GPS systems offer unparalleled location accuracy, ensuring that businesses can pinpoint the exact whereabouts of their assets within a few meters. Cloud-based Track and Trace Systems
Take advantage of cloud-based solutions to efficiently monitor and manage your assets, vehicles, and shipments. With real-time visibility provided by these systems, you can track your goods’ exact location and status at any given time. This allows you to quickly identify any bottlenecks or delays in your supply chain and take immediate action to resolve them.
Cloud-based track and trace systems also enable supply chain optimization by analyzing data collected from various sources, such as GPS-enabled devices and sensors. By leveraging this information, you can make informed decisions to streamline processes, reduce costs, and improve overall efficiency.
The cloud-based nature of these solutions ensures that all stakeholders have access to up-to-date information anytime, anywhere, fostering collaboration and enhancing customer satisfaction.

Predictive analytics and proactive decision-making
You can revolutionize your decision-making process by utilizing predictive analytics and proactively addressing potential supply chain disruptions. With the advancements in technology, predictive modeling has become an essential tool for businesses to forecast future outcomes based on historical data. By analyzing patterns and trends, you can gain valuable insights into potential risks and vulnerabilities within your supply chain.
Real-time monitoring plays a crucial role in this process, allowing you to track and analyze data in real time, enabling proactive decision-making.
Here are three ways predictive analytics and proactive decision-making can benefit your organization:
- Minimize downtime: By identifying potential disruptions before they occur, you can take preventive measures to minimize downtime and keep operations running smoothly.
- Optimize inventory management: Predictive analytics helps you forecast demand accurately, ensuring optimal inventory levels and reducing excess stock or shortages.
- Enhance customer satisfaction: Proactive decision-making based on accurate predictions allows you to meet customer demands efficiently, leading to improved satisfaction.
